What are terminal services?
Expert
Terminal Services are constituent of Microsoft Windows operating systems (that is, both client and server versions) which permits a user to access applications or data stored on a remote computer over a network association. Terminal Services is Microsoft's take on server centric computing, that permits individual users to access network resources simply.
